Dubai, UAE; April 9, 2014: Tradewinds Corporation, the premier leisure and hospitality owner-operator in Malaysia chaired by Mohamed Alabbar and backed by The Albukhary Group, today unveiled the masterplan of its flagship project Perdana Quay, with a gross development value of AED 4.5 billion (US$1.2 billion), in Langkawi.

Perdana Quay is the island's first-ever integrated leisure, retail, residential and commercial development, targeted at luxury travellers seeking an ecological and nature-oriented option to more conventional destinations like Phuket and Bali.

Malaysian Prime Minister Mohd Najib Tun Razak unveiled the masterplan and also marked the ground-breaking of The Burau Langkawi, a luxury deluxe resort that marks the first phase of Perdana Quay, in the presence of Dr. Mahathir Mohamad, former Prime Minister; Mukhriz Mahathir, the Chief Minister of Kedah state; and Mohamed Alabbar.

The Burau Langkawi is expected to be completed by end-2017, and will feature 245 deluxe rooms and 60 luxury villas including 26 ultra-luxury villas on Pulau Anak Burau. Nestled in a sheltered bay on the island's north-western corner facing the Andaman Sea, Perdana Quay will be developed over 10 years in six phases and is aimed at tourists from fast-growing Asian countries like China, Singapore and the Middle East. Spread over 240 acres of land at Pantai Kok-Teluk Burau on the northwest of the island, the project will be developed into five distinct components, including waterfront holiday villas, lake homes and other luxury residential properties.

Tradewinds Corporation has bespoke luxury and ecologically conscious resort properties employing such prestigious brands under its stable as Hilton, Istana, Mutiara and Meritus. Perdana Quay further underlines The Albukhary Group's commitment to Langkawi and is its newest project in the island following the Rebak Island Resort, which is privately-owned by the group.
